Why CRM Software Matters for Sales Teams

Before delving into specific CRM solutions, it’s essential to understand why CRM software is critical for sales teams:

  1. Centralized Data Management: CRM systems consolidate customer data from various sources, allowing sales teams to access a comprehensive view of customer interactions, preferences, and history. This centralized approach enables better decision-making and enhances customer engagement.
  2. Improved Communication: CRM tools streamline communication between team members and clients. Features such as shared notes, task assignments, and real-time updates facilitate collaboration and ensure everyone is on the same page.
  3. Enhanced Sales Forecasting: CRM software often includes advanced analytics and reporting tools that help sales teams analyze their performance, forecast future sales, and identify trends. This data-driven approach empowers teams to make informed decisions and adapt strategies accordingly.
  4. Automation of Repetitive Tasks: Many CRM solutions offer automation features that reduce the time spent on repetitive tasks such as data entry, lead nurturing, and follow-ups. This automation allows sales professionals to focus more on building relationships and closing deals.
  5. Customization and Scalability: As businesses grow and change, their CRM needs may evolve. Modern CRM systems often offer customization options, allowing sales teams to tailor the software to fit their specific workflows and processes.

Top CRM Software for Sales Teams

1. Salesforce

Overview: Salesforce is a leading CRM platform known for its extensive features and customization options. It is designed to cater to businesses of all sizes, making it a favorite among sales teams.

Key Features:

  • Lead and Opportunity Management: Salesforce provides tools to track leads and manage sales opportunities throughout the pipeline.
  • Automation: Workflow automation capabilities allow sales teams to automate repetitive tasks, such as sending follow-up emails and updating records.
  • Reports and Dashboards: Customizable dashboards and in-depth reporting tools help sales professionals track their performance and gain insights into sales trends.
  • AppExchange: A marketplace for third-party applications that can enhance Salesforce’s capabilities.

Benefits: Salesforce enables sales teams to streamline their processes, improve collaboration, and enhance overall productivity. Its robust analytics capabilities allow for data-driven decision-making.

Best For: Mid-sized to large organizations with complex sales processes and the need for extensive customization.

2. HubSpot CRM

Overview: HubSpot CRM is a user-friendly solution designed for businesses of all sizes, particularly startups and small to medium-sized enterprises. It offers a robust free version with essential features.

Key Features:

  • Contact Management: HubSpot allows users to manage contacts easily and track their interactions with the business.
  • Sales Automation: The platform automates tasks like email tracking, follow-up reminders, and pipeline updates.
  • Integrated Marketing Tools: HubSpot’s CRM integrates seamlessly with its marketing automation tools, enabling sales teams to align their efforts with marketing campaigns.
  • Reporting and Analytics: Users can generate reports to analyze sales performance, track key metrics, and identify trends.

Benefits: HubSpot CRM is intuitive and easy to use, making it ideal for sales teams looking to improve efficiency without a steep learning curve. Its free version provides significant functionality for small businesses.

Best For: Startups and small to medium-sized businesses seeking a simple yet effective CRM solution.

3. Pipedrive

Overview: Pipedrive is a sales-focused CRM designed to help sales teams manage their pipelines effectively. Its user-friendly interface and visual sales pipeline make it popular among sales professionals.

Key Features:

  • Visual Sales Pipeline: Pipedrive’s drag-and-drop pipeline view allows users to easily manage deals and track their progress.
  • Activity and Goal Tracking: Sales reps can set goals and track their activities to ensure they stay on target.
  • Email Integration: Pipedrive integrates with popular email services, enabling users to manage their communications directly from the CRM.
  • Customizable Fields: Users can tailor the CRM to fit their specific sales processes by creating custom fields and stages.

Benefits: Pipedrive helps sales teams stay organized and focused on closing deals. Its intuitive design and visual approach make it easy for sales professionals to manage their sales activities.

Best For: Sales teams looking for a straightforward and visually oriented CRM solution.

4. Zoho CRM

Overview: Zoho CRM is a comprehensive CRM solution that caters to businesses of all sizes. It offers a wide range of features, including automation, analytics, and customization options.

Key Features:

  • Lead and Contact Management: Zoho CRM allows users to manage leads and contacts effectively, with tools to track interactions and engagement.
  • Sales Automation: The platform automates tasks such as lead scoring, follow-ups, and email campaigns.
  • Analytics and Reporting: Users can access powerful analytics tools to track sales performance and generate reports for better insights.
  • Customization: Zoho CRM offers extensive customization options, allowing businesses to tailor the software to their specific needs.

Benefits: Zoho CRM provides a cost-effective solution with a rich feature set, making it suitable for businesses looking to enhance their sales processes without breaking the bank.

Best For: Small to medium-sized businesses seeking a customizable and affordable CRM solution.

5. Microsoft Dynamics 365

Overview: Microsoft Dynamics 365 is an integrated CRM and ERP solution that offers powerful tools for sales teams. Its flexibility and integration with other Microsoft products make it a strong contender.

Key Features:

  • Sales Management: Dynamics 365 allows users to manage leads, opportunities, and accounts efficiently.
  • Artificial Intelligence (AI): The platform uses AI to provide sales insights and recommendations, helping teams make data-driven decisions.
  • Integration with Microsoft Tools: Seamless integration with Microsoft Office products enhances collaboration and productivity.
  • Customizable Dashboards: Users can create personalized dashboards to track key metrics and performance indicators.

Benefits: Dynamics 365 offers a comprehensive solution for organizations looking to integrate sales and operations. Its AI capabilities help sales teams work smarter and improve their performance.

Best For: Larger organizations that require an integrated CRM and ERP solution with advanced features.

6. Freshsales

Overview: Freshsales, part of the Freshworks suite, is a CRM solution designed for businesses looking to streamline their sales processes. It offers a range of features tailored to sales teams.

Key Features:

  • Lead Scoring: Freshsales automatically scores leads based on engagement, helping sales teams prioritize their efforts.
  • Visual Sales Pipeline: The platform features a visual pipeline that allows users to track deals and manage their sales processes easily.
  • Email Tracking: Users can track email interactions and receive notifications when prospects open their emails.
  • Built-in Phone System: Freshsales includes a built-in phone system for making calls directly from the CRM.

Benefits: Freshsales combines essential CRM features with a user-friendly interface, making it suitable for sales teams looking for an all-in-one solution.

Best For: Small to medium-sized businesses seeking a straightforward and effective CRM for their sales teams.

7. Nimble

Overview: Nimble is a social CRM that helps sales teams build relationships by integrating social media data with traditional CRM functionalities. It’s particularly useful for businesses that rely on social selling.

Key Features:

  • Social Media Integration: Nimble aggregates social media profiles and interactions, allowing users to engage with contacts on various platforms.
  • Contact Management: The platform offers tools for managing contacts, tracking interactions, and maintaining detailed profiles.
  • Relationship Management: Users can set reminders and track follow-ups to nurture relationships effectively.
  • Email Tracking: Nimble provides email tracking features, allowing sales teams to see when their emails are opened.

Benefits: Nimble helps sales professionals leverage social media to connect with customers and build meaningful relationships, enhancing their overall sales efforts.

Best For: Sales teams that prioritize social selling and relationship building.
